The Benefits of Bananas
Bananas are not only delicious but also highly nutritious, offering a range of health benefits. Rich in vitamins, minerals, and fiber, bananas are an excellent source of potassium, which is essential for maintaining proper heart and muscle function. They are also packed with vitamin B6, which helps with brain health and the production of neurotransmitters. The natural sugars in bananas, primarily fructose, provide a quick energy boost, making them an ideal snack before or after a workout.
In addition to their nutritional value, bananas contain soluble fiber, which aids in digestion and helps maintain a healthy gut. The fiber in bananas can also help regulate blood sugar levels by slowing down the absorption of sugar into the bloodstream, making them a great option for those looking to manage their blood sugar levels.

How to Make the Perfect Cinnamon-Sugar Banana Chips
Making Cinnamon-Sugar Air Fryer Banana Chips is a straightforward process, but there are a few tips to ensure the best results. First, it’s essential to use ripe but firm bananas. Overripe bananas can become too mushy and won’t crisp up as nicely in the air fryer. Look for bananas that are fully ripe, with yellow skin and a few brown spots, but not too soft.
Next, slice the bananas into even rounds about ⅛ inch thick. Thin slices will crisp up more evenly, giving you that perfect chip-like texture. Be sure not to cut them too thick, as they may not crisp up properly.
Coating the banana slices lightly with olive oil or cooking spray helps to achieve the desired crispness. You don’t need to use a lot of oil—just enough to give the slices a light, even coating. This helps the cinnamon-sugar mixture stick to the banana slices while they cook.
The cinnamon-sugar mixture can be adjusted to taste. If you prefer a more intense cinnamon flavor, add a bit more cinnamon to the mix. If you’d like a lighter sweetness, reduce the sugar. You can also experiment with adding other spices like nutmeg or allspice to create a more complex flavor profile.
Once the banana slices are coated and placed in the air fryer basket, it’s important not to overcrowd them. Arrange the slices in a single layer, ensuring they have enough space for the hot air to circulate around them. This helps them cook evenly and become crispy on all sides. Depending on the size of your air fryer, you may need to cook the banana chips in batches.
Serving and Storing Cinnamon-Sugar Air Fryer Banana Chips
Once your Cinnamon-Sugar Air Fryer Banana Chips are cooked, let them cool on a wire rack. This cooling process allows them to crisp up even further. The result is a perfectly crunchy, sweet snack that can be enjoyed right away or stored for later.
These chips are best enjoyed fresh, but they can be stored in an airtight container for up to a few days. Make sure to keep them in a cool, dry place to maintain their crispiness. If they do lose some of their crunch, you can easily crisp them back up in the air fryer for a few minutes before serving.
